ABOUT ㅣ BEEF S2
Launch Date: April 16, 2026
Format: 8-episodes, Anthology Series
Creator/Showrunner/Executive Producer: Lee Sung Jin
Executive Producers: Jake Schreier, Steven Yeun, Ali Wong, Carey Mulligan, Oscar Isaac, Charles Melton, Cailee Spaeny, Anna Moench, Kitao Sakurai and Ethan Kuperberg
Series Regulars: Oscar Isaac (Josh), Carey Mulligan (Lindsay), Charles Melton (Austin), Cailee Spaeny (Ashley), Seoyeon Jang (Eunice)
Additional Cast: Youn Yuh-jung (Chairwoman Park), Song Kang-Ho (Dr. Kim), William Fichtner (Troy), Mikaela Hoover (Ava), BM (Woosh)
Studio: A24
BEEF returns with a new cast and a new "beef," as a Gen-Z couple witnesses an alarming fight between their Millennial boss and his wife. Newly-engaged Ashley Miller (Cailee Spaeny) and Austin Davis (Charles Melton), both lower-level staff at a country club, become entangled in the unraveling marriage of their General Manager, Joshua Martín (Oscar Isaac), and his wife, Lindsay Crane-Martín (Carey Mulligan). Through favors and coercion, both couples vie for the approval of the elitist club's billionaire owner, Chairwoman Park (Youn Yuh-jung), who struggles to manage her own scandal involving her second husband, Doctor Kim (Song Kang-ho).
The first installment of BEEF, starring Steven Yeun and Ali Wong, premiered in 2023 and went on to become the most recognized and award-winning anthology series of the 2023-2024 season with wins including 8 Emmy Awards, 4 Critics Choice Awards, 3 Golden Globe Awards, 2 Gotham Awards, 2 Film Independent Spirit Awards, 2 SAG Awards, as well as PGA, WGA and AFI Honors. The series also resonated with audiences around the globe, claiming a spot on the Netflix Global Top 10 for five consecutive weeks.
